虚拟主机重建数据库的步骤
虚拟主机上重建数据库通常涉及以下几个步骤:首先备份当前数据库;然后卸载旧版本的数据库软件和相关服务;接着安装新版本的数据库软件并配置环境;最后进行数据迁移和测试,操作前应确保已备份所有重要数据,并且了解目标服务器上的系统兼容性和硬件要求。
虚拟主机重建数据库的步骤指南
在互联网时代,虚拟主机已成为一种非常普遍且实用的服务器托管解决方案,无论是个人博客、小型企业网站还是大型电子商务平台,都依赖于虚拟主机提供的强大计算能力和高可用性,定期维护和更新虚拟主机以确保其稳定性和安全性是非常必要的,一个常见需求便是重新构建数据库,以保证数据的一致性和完整性,本文将详细指导您如何通过虚拟主机重新构建数据库。
准备工作
在开始任何数据库重建之前,请确保以下几点:
- 备份:对所有需要恢复的数据进行完整备份,这既包括结构化数据(如表、字段等),也包括非结构化数据(如图片、视频文件)。
- 关闭服务:确保您的应用程序和服务已经停止运行,以便避免在操作过程中出现意外中断。
- 安全措施:如果可能,尝试在无人访问的情况下执行数据库操作,或者至少在有监控的情况下进行。
使用命令行工具
对于大多数MySQL或MariaDB数据库系统,可以使用`mysqldump`命令来备份整个数据库,并使用`mysql`命令来恢复,以下是具体步骤:
备份数据库
打开终端或命令提示符窗口,进入包含MySQL安装目录的目录,然后运行以下命令来备份数据库:
mysqldump -u username -p database_name > backup.sql
这里,`username`是你的MySQL用户名,`database_name`是你想要备份的数据库名,请确保替换这部分为实际值。
移动备份到新位置
完成后,你需要将备份文件迁移到新的数据库位置,这通常涉及到复制备份文件到新服务器上并导入数据库。
在新服务器上,使用相同的SQL语句来导入备份文件:
source /path/to/backup.sql;
请根据实际情况调整路径和参数。
验证数据库重建
一旦数据库成功从旧位置迁移至新位置,你可以通过以下步骤验证数据是否正确迁移到了新位置:
- 检查文件大小:确保备份文件大小与预期一致。
- 检查数据完整性:手动比较两个数据库中的相同记录,以确认数据没有丢失或损坏。
- 运行测试脚本:创建一些简单的测试查询,以验证数据库功能正常运作。
清理临时文件
完成数据库重建后,删除之前的备份文件和其他不必要的中间文件,以保持磁盘空间整洁。
启动应用服务
启动你的应用程序或服务,确保一切恢复正常运行状态。
通过以上步骤,您可以在虚拟主机环境中成功地重建数据库,尽管这个过程相对简单,但仍需仔细阅读每一步的具体细节,以防可能出现问题,定期备份和监控也是维护数据库健康的关键手段,建议设置定期自动备份计划和性能监控机制。
文章底部单独广告 |
版权声明
本站原创内容未经允许不得转载,或转载时需注明出处:特网云知识库
上一篇:复刻虚拟主机价格查询 下一篇:了解,阿里云8核32G服务器租赁费用解析